Who Killed Merlin the Great?

Season 2, Episode 11, Aired
EDIT

Episode Summary

Merlin the Great's famous escape-from-a-coffin trick backfires when it is discovered that he has been shot while "buried" in a hotel pool - but how was it done? and which of the rival magicians has a deadly trick up their sleeve? The only clues are a feather found on the body and the grave of someone named "Miriam". Whodunit? Was it the lovely magician's assistant, the escape artist, the fortune teller, the hotel doctor, the ventriloquist or the knife thrower? A phony seance exposes the real culprit.moreless

      • The key clue of the pillow feather will show up over ten years later in an episode of "Columbo" (episode #29--"Troubled Waters"). Of course, Levinson and Link created this show too. [RW] Edit
      • Talk about popular! The exact same murder set-up appears 30 years later in the Burke's Law (1994) episode "Who Killed Alexander the Great?" Edit
